PRESS RELEASE

HANDICAPPING RATINGS UPDATE

Daily News 2000 (Grade 1)

GREEN WITH ENVY was adjusted to a rating of 127 from 123 following his success in the Grade 1 Daily News 2000 over 2000m on the turf track at Hollywoodbets Greyville on Saturday 25 May.   The Handicappers believed that MID WINTER WIND made for the most suitable line horse here and his rating remained unchanged on 116. It was also considered that MID WINTER WIND was attempting the 2000m trip for the first time in his career and felt the evidence suggested that he saw out the extra distance comfortably. MID WINTER WIND did appear to at least confirm his 5th place in the Grade 2 KZN Guineas in this event when also finishing in 5th place. Furthermore, the Handicappers also observed his official sectional time (courtesy of Hollywoodbets) found on the gallop.co.za website is as follows

:Horse Form – Mid Winter Wind – (gallop.co.za)

 


As is evident above, MID WINTER WIND produced a 800m to finish time of 47.951 in the KZN Guineas(1600m) and 47.861 in the Daily News 2000 (2000m) and a 400m to finish time of 23.159 in the KZN Guineas (1600m) and 23.274 in the Daily News 2000 (2000m). Given the factual evidence at hand, the Handicappers feel that MID WINTER WIND comfortably stayed the distance as a matter of fact.

In rating the race using MID WINTER WIND as the line, PURE PREDATOR runs to a rating of 116 which is a rating he achieved in the Grade 1 SA Classic and the Grade 1 SA Derby, this effectively makes him a line horse as well and there are certainly no stamina doubts about this horse who has been a model of consistency.

The previously unexposed runner up, FLAG MAN was adjusted to 126 from 92. His improvement here can be attributed to the fact that he has gone from winning a Middle Stakes race to narrowly losing a Grade 1 event. The 3rdplace finisher, BARBARESCO was increased to 122 from 109 and has also recorded his 1st Grade 1 placing. These adjustments placed the top 3 horses in the correct Handicap rankings with PURE PREDATOR (119) and MID WINTER WIND (116).

HLUHLUWE was given a 1-point drop from 117 to 116 so that he is not rated higher than the 116 rated MID WINTER WIND. The only other horse to have received a change in rating was WILLIAM IRON ARM who was dropped to 114 from 117.

Please note that the connections of the winner, GREEN WITH ENVY, have lodged an appeal against the merit rating adjustment he received for this event. The NHA will do a press release after the appeal is heard by an independent appeals panel.

Tabgold Woolavington 2000 (Grade 1)

SILVER SANCTUARY remained unaltered on a rating of 116 after she won the Grade 1 Woolavington 2000 for fillies and mares over 2000m at Hollywoodbets Greyville on Saturday.  Here, the Handicappers believed that the winner made for the most suitable line horse, hence her unchanged rating.

In arriving at this decision, the Handicappers took into consideration that this race was run at a very sedate pace, this is evident in the fact that the time recorded for this event was 2.17 seconds slower than the time recorded for the Grade 1 Daily News 2000.

Runner-up HOLD MY HAND, who was the only runner to receive a rating increase in this event, was raised from 108 to 114.

The only horse to receive a drop in ratings was MY SOUL MATE, who dropped from 115 to 113.

Lonsdale Stirrup Cup (Handicap) (Listed)

DOWN TO BUSINESS has had his rating raised from 98 to 101 after winning the Listed Lonsdale Stirrup Cup (handicap) over 2400m at Hollywoodbets Greyville on Saturday.  The Handicappers believed that the runner-up RAISEAHALLELUJAH made for the most suitable line horse, leaving him unchanged on 99.  In assessing the race this way 3rd finisher BARATHEON ran to a mark of 98 and 4th finisher INDIAN OCEAN ran to a mark of 95 and were both accordingly adjusted to their performance figures.

The only other horse to receive an increase in ratings was PIRATE PRINCE, who was adjusted to 92 from 89.

Two horses received drops to their ratings, NEBRAAS was dropped to 106 from 108 and GOOD COUNCIL was dropped to 103 from 105.

Pocket Power Stakes (Grade 3)

THE FUTURIST was adjusted to a rating of 104 from 98 after emphatically winning the Grade 3 Pocket Power Stakes over 1950m at Hollywoodbets Kenilworth (winter course) on Sunday.

The Handicappers felt that OTTO LUYKEN made for the most suitable line horse here and his rating remained unchanged on 97. The winner was protected by a 6-point merit rating cap due to the specific race conditions which state that the first three finishers may receive up to a maximum of a 6-point increment.

In any case, the Handicappers were not going to take the 9,25 lengths winning margin literally given this horse’s overall profile and the probability that THE FUTURIST may well be flattered by an enterprising ride.

Three horses received a drop in ratings, NAVY STRENGTH was dropped to 101 from 102, FLOWER OF SAIGON dropped to 102 from 104 and FUTURE PRINCE was restored to 95 from 100 after failing to confirm the increment he received for his performance in the Grade 3 Variety Club Mile.

Stormsvlei Stakes (Listed)

RED PALACE remained unchanged on a mark of 108 after leading from start to finish to land the Listed Stormsvlei Stakes over 1800m at Hollywoodbets Kenilworth (winter course) on Sunday.

PRINCESS IZZY was deemed to make for the most suitable line horse and she remained unchanged on a rating of 99. The runner up, LOVE IS A ROSE was increased from 101 to 104 after shouldering top weight while the 3rdplaced TIME FOR LOVE was adjusted to 94 from 88. TIME FOR LOVE actually ran to a higher mark but her rating was capped to a 6 point increase due to the specific condition that state the first three finishers may only incur and increment of up to 6 points.

The following horses received drop in ratings, BROADWAY GIRL is down to 87 from 88, WINDRUNNER dropped to 83 from 86 and DOUBLE CHECK dropped to 85 from 88.

Milkwood Stakes (Listed)

PARIS LASS received an increase from 94 to 103 after she won the Listed Milkwood Stakes for fillies and mares over 1000m on the Polytrack at Fairview on Friday.  The race was originally scheduled for the turf course but was moved to the Polytrack because of weather-related reasons for the 2nd year running.

In assessing the race, the Handicappers felt that 3rd placed GIMME’S LASSIE made for the most suitable line horse, and she remained on a rating of 101. In rating the race this way, the runner-up THREE ROCKS ran below her rating hence her unchanged rating of 109.

The only other horse to receive and increase in the ratings was MISS GREENLIGHT, who was given a marginal increase from 88 to 92.

Three horses received drops to their ratings, GOLDEN PACIFIC was dropped to 100 from 101, ANCIENT EPIC was dropped from 90 to 88 and AUNTY LIZZY was dropped from 88 to 86.

First I'll post the SECTIONAL ANALYSIS of both the Guineas and the DAILY NEWS....

RAW   TIMES

RACE
                 1st  200m              1st  400m         1st  600m        1st 800m         L400m          L200m         L100m

GUINEAS             12.68                      24.34                  36.07                47.80            23.49            11.82             6.04

DAILY NEWS        13.42                     25.61                  37.89                50.67            22.51             11.47            5.88

Without par times this Info is almost useless. It's 2 different distances run on different days with different track conditions. EARLY PACE (EP) is always slower as we go up in distances,generally! Meaning that the further in distance we go....the slower the EP. So HOW can we compare these 2 races? Honestly speaking....WE CANT!!!!! But we can DEFNITELY Compare the PERFORMANCE OF EACH HORSE,INDIVIDUALLY within the races itself.We do that by using the FINISHING SPEEDS (FS) of the horses and comparing it to The OVERALL RACE FINISHING SPEED (ORFS) of the race itself. To understand VS you can gladly read up about it in SIMON ROWLANDS booklet about SECTIONAL TIMING (ST). Admittedly,it took me a long time to 'fully understand' it but still I would say I'm still learning everyday (or try to atleast). I still do about 1 - 3 hours research on the topic daily (or as much as times allow me). That it is of great benefit is no doubt to me and understanding it would improve your success rate tremendously.


FINISHING SPEEDS

RACE                                  L600%             L400%                   L200%                   L100%

GUINEAS  ORFS:               104.38%          102.86%               102.21%                100.01%

GREEN WITH ENVY:      105.02%           106.53%               104.69%                103.25%

SAN SUMMIT:                 104.14%           106.03%              102.78%                 100.22%

MID WINTER WIND:        102.95%          104.70%               101.71%                  100.53%


Now if we Look at the FS of MWW and compare it with the OFS of the race itself....u can see he was very much on par with the race FS itself the L400M meaning he was STAYING ON EASILY even thou the 2 above him are in a league of their own. Next we look at the DAILY NEWS

RACE                                    L600%                L400%              L200%             L100%

DAILY NEWS ORFS               106.13%            109.89%          107.83%          105.17%

GREEN WITH ENVY            108.80%            110.08%          107.82%          105.17%

FLAG MAN                            106.94%            109.80%          108.12%           106.27%

BARBERESCO                      107.61%             109.69%          107.64%          105.18%

MID WINTER WIND             105.84%              107.10%          104.98%          103.67%

A LOT can be learned from the above....Let me Look at the TOP 2 1st....

GREEN WITH ENVY and FLAG MAN....

The RACE was run at a VERY SLOW PACE (VSP) as I previously pointed out thus favouring FM much more than it did GWE. The sectionals and FS produced by GWE is simply ridiculous. FM on the other hand did not run to his 'rating' of his previous run where his FS were simply phenomenal. I think he should be ridden cold and than we will see his real potencial again. BUT the L200M he showed his class (atleast to me) in no uncertain terms. He beat GWE in FS in the last furlong. I can write that down to the amount of WASTED ENERGY (WE) that GWE had to endure but still for FM to better the ORFS showed in no uncertain terms HE IS CLASS!!!!!

The FS of BARBERESCO underlines what Frodo said.....He is DEFINITELY value at that price.

Now...let's get to the subject of this post.....MID WINTER WIND.

Before that...let me make a worldly example WE ALL can understand simply enough...

Athletics....Let's say I run the 100m and 400m

I would probably run the 100m in 25 seconds (I think,lol) now I  can probably run the LAST 100M  of a 400M RACE also in 25 seconds....but only if I walked the 1st 300m of it.....So does that mean I can run 400m and STAY ON to finish the Last 100m in 25 seconds???? Hahahahaahahaha of cos I can...hahahahahaha in my wildest dreams!!!!!

Thatis the case off what happened here....They walked in the DN thus they could Sprint home like that. So MID WINTER WIND (and the rest actually finished faster) could run more or less the same L800 and L400 ST.

The FS of MWW in the Guineas showed that he was on par with the race itself....He did not get that much tired butjust isn't the same class as those before But if we COMPARE his FS with that off the ORFS in the DN than you would see him dipping below that mark quite significantly. Thus meaning he was SLOWING DOWN FASTER than the race being run meaning....HE DID NOT SEE OUT THE DISTANCE at all....and THAT IS AN FACT!!!!! It was a VSP and the fact that he slowed down so much is prove that this is not his distance (maybe in the future when he has strengthen?) But I highly doubt that.

So for future references, if the handicappers use that kind of reasoning to adjust ratings....Form Studiers will be in trouble becoz the ratings will be wrong!!!!(They will never be right, but they will be further wrong)

We can't just look at ST as different things come together to achieve them but when 1 use FS along with them it is possible to put into context those times and what we see.

PRESS RELEASE

MERIT RATING APPEAL
An independent National Horseracing Authority of Southern Africa (NHA) Merit Rating Appeal panel consisting of Messrs G Soma, K Miedema and A Sewpersad was convened virtually on 3 June 2024. The panel considered a Merit Rating Appeal lodged by Trainer Mr D Kannemeyer against the published adjusted merit rating of GREEN WITH ENVY of 127 (from 123) after his win in the DAILY NEWS 2000 (Grade 1) at Hollywoodbets Greyville Racecourse on 25 May 2024.

The Appeal Panel, after careful consideration, unanimously agreed that MID WINTER WIND was a reasonable line horse in this race, as in their opinion, the other reasonable line horse options available, if selected, would have resulted in GREEN WITH ENVY incurring a higher merit rating.

Consequently, the Merit Rating Appeal was dismissed.

The Appeal Panel ruled that the deposit fee in relation to the Appeal be declared forfeit.
